Gabor Kelemen (kelemeng) wrote : Can't use c-n-r-gtk to initate Quantal -> Raring update

I have submitted an apport report for this already, but I think it is better to submit it manually too.
I have tried to run
/usr/lib/ubuntu-release-upgrader/check-new-release-gtk -d
just to see what happens next. It has found the Raring release, I have pushed the "Yes, Upgrade Now!" button, and got this:

$ /usr/lib/ubuntu-release-upgrader/check-new-release-gtk -d
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/usr/lib/ubuntu-release-upgrader/check-new-release-gtk", line 132, in on_button_upgrade_now_clicked
    _("Downloading the release upgrade tool"))
  File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/DistUpgrade/GtkProgress.py", line 35, in __init__
    self.widgets = SimpleGtkbuilderApp(uifile, "ubuntu-release-upgrader")
  File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/DistUpgrade/SimpleGtk3builderApp.py", line 32, in __init__
    self.builder.add_from_file(path)
  File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/gi/types.py", line 47, in function
    return info.invoke(*args, **kwargs)
gi._glib.GError: Nem sikerült megnyitni a(z) „/usr/share/ubuntu-release-upgradergtkbuilder/AcquireProgress.ui” fájlt: Nincs ilyen fájl vagy könyvtár

(gi._glib.GError: Can't open the ...ui file: No such file or directory)

That would be easy to fix, I tried to do the following to DistUpgrade/GtkProgress.py :
- uifile = datadir + "gtkbuilder/AcquireProgress.ui"
+ uifile = datadir + "/gtkbuilder/AcquireProgress.ui"

But now a brand new crash happens, and I'm stuck:

$ /usr/lib/ubuntu-release-upgrader/check-new-release-gtk -d
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/usr/lib/ubuntu-release-upgrader/check-new-release-gtk", line 132, in on_button_upgrade_now_clicked
    _("Downloading the release upgrade tool"))
  File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/DistUpgrade/GtkProgress.py", line 48, in __init__
    self.window_fetch.set_transient_for(parent)
  File "/usr/lib/python3/dist-packages/gi/types.py", line 47, in function
    return info.invoke(*args, **kwargs)
TypeError: argument parent: Expected Gtk.Window, but got __main__.CheckNewReleaseGtk
